word文档太大为什么会崩溃
作者:路由通
|
152人看过
发布时间:2026-05-02 15:42:13
标签:
当我们处理一个庞大的Word文档时,时常会遇到程序无响应、卡顿甚至直接崩溃退出的情况。这背后并非单一原因所致,而是由文档体积过大所引发的一系列连锁技术问题。本文将深入剖析其核心机理,从内存资源耗竭、文件内部结构冗余、图形对象处理负担到软件自身的运行限制等多个维度,系统性地解释文档过大导致崩溃的根本原因,并提供一系列经过验证的预防与修复策略,帮助用户从根本上理解和解决这一常见难题。
在日常办公与文档处理中,微软的Word软件无疑是使用最广泛的工具之一。然而,许多用户都曾经历过这样的窘境:辛辛苦苦编辑了数十页甚至上百页的文档,包含了丰富的图片、表格和复杂格式,正当准备保存或进行下一步操作时,软件界面突然凝固,弹出一个令人沮丧的“未响应”提示,或是直接闪退回桌面。这种崩溃不仅打断了工作流程,更可能导致未保存的内容丢失,带来难以估量的损失。问题的矛头往往直指一个共同的特征——文档体积过大。一个Word文档从流畅运行到不堪重负直至崩溃,其背后隐藏着一套复杂的技术逻辑。本文将抽丝剥茧,为您详细解读“Word文档太大为什么会崩溃”的十二个核心层面。
一、 系统与软件内存资源耗竭 Word软件在运行时,需要将文档内容加载到计算机的随机存取存储器(内存)中进行处理和显示。当文档体积巨大,尤其是包含大量高分辨率图片时,其对内存的占用量会急剧攀升。如果文档所需内存超过了软件可分配的上限,或是接近了操作系统为单个程序设定的内存限额,Word就会因无法获取足够的工作空间而陷入停滞或崩溃。这类似于一个仓库只能容纳十吨货物,却硬要塞进二十吨,其结果必然是系统崩溃。 二、 临时文件与缓存机制过载 为了提升编辑时的响应速度,Word在运行过程中会生成大量的临时文件,用于存储撤销历史、自动恢复信息以及文档的缓存版本。对于超大文档,这些临时文件的体积也会同步膨胀,可能达到数百兆字节。它们通常存储在系统盘(通常是C盘)。如果系统盘剩余空间不足,Word将无法顺利创建或写入这些临时文件,导致操作失败,进而引发程序异常关闭。定期清理系统临时文件夹和确保系统盘有充足空间至关重要。 三、 文档内部代码结构冗余与损坏 从技术角度看,Word文档(.docx格式)本质上是一个压缩包,其中包含了用可扩展标记语言(XML)编写的文本内容、样式定义以及媒体资源等。在反复编辑,特别是频繁进行格式复制粘贴、插入删除的过程中,文档的XML结构可能变得异常臃肿和混乱,产生大量无用的冗余代码。这些“代码垃圾”并不会在界面显示,却会显著增加文件体积,并使得Word在解析和渲染文档时负担沉重,解析错误累积到一定程度就可能直接导致崩溃。 四、 嵌入式对象与OLE技术瓶颈 许多用户喜欢在Word中直接嵌入其他应用程序的对象,如完整的Excel表格、演示文稿(PowerPoint)幻灯片,或复杂的图表。这些对象通过对象链接与嵌入(OLE)技术整合。每个嵌入对象都相当于在Word内部运行另一个小型程序实例。当文档中此类对象过多或体积过大时,它们会持续占用处理器和内存资源,对象之间的通信与刷新极易成为性能瓶颈,大大增加了系统不稳定和崩溃的风险。 五、 高分辨率图片与未压缩的图形 这是导致文档体积暴增最常见的原因。直接从数码相机或网络插入的图片,其分辨率可能远高于屏幕显示所需,单张图片就达到数兆甚至数十兆字节。Word默认会保留这些图片的原始数据。当文档中堆积了数十张此类图片时,总体积轻松突破百兆。在滚动浏览或编辑时,Word需要实时解码和重绘这些图片,对图形处理器和内存造成巨大压力,卡顿和崩溃随之而来。 六、 复杂格式与样式的连锁效应 过度使用或嵌套使用复杂的格式设置,如多重阴影、三维效果、艺术字、以及海量的手动段落格式(而非使用样式),都会使得文档的渲染逻辑变得极其复杂。Word需要为每一个字符、每一个段落计算其最终的显示效果。在大文档中,这种计算量呈指数级增长。尤其是在执行全文替换格式、更新目录或打印预览等需要重新计算整个文档布局的操作时,软件极易因处理超时或资源冲突而崩溃。 七、 宏代码与自动化脚本错误 一些专业文档或模板中可能包含了用于自动执行任务的宏(使用Visual Basic for Applications编写)。如果宏代码编写不当,存在死循环、内存泄漏或对大型对象集合(如遍历所有段落)进行低效操作,那么在处理大文档时,这些缺陷会被放大。一个陷入无限循环的宏可以瞬间耗尽所有处理器资源,导致Word完全冻结,只能通过任务管理器强制结束进程。 八、 版本兼容性与文件格式冲突 使用较新版本Word(如Microsoft 365)创建和编辑的包含大量高级功能的文档,在尝试用旧版本(如Word 2010)打开时,可能会遇到兼容性问题。旧版本软件需要额外处理它无法完全识别的新特性代码,这个过程可能充满错误。同样,从其他文字处理软件(如WPS)转换而来的大文档,其内部格式映射可能不完美,遗留的格式冲突点在体积膨胀后更容易触发解析异常,导致打开或保存时崩溃。 九、 字体嵌入与缺失字体的处理负担 为了确保文档在不同电脑上显示一致,用户可能会选择“嵌入字体”。这将所用字体的全部或部分字符集数据打包进文档文件,对于包含多种特殊字体的大文档,此举会显著增加文件体积。另一方面,如果文档使用了某台电脑上没有安装的字体,Word需要尝试寻找替代字体并重新计算排版,这个过程对于大文档来说计算量巨大,且可能引发布局错乱,进而增加不稳定因素。 十、 修订与批注历史积累如山 在团队协作中,长期开启“修订”功能会让文档记录下每一次插入、删除和格式更改的历史。同时,大量的批注(注释)也会嵌入文档。对于一份经历了多轮修改的大文档,这些历史数据可能比文档当前的内容还要庞大。Word需要随时跟踪、存储和显示这些信息,尤其是在滚动浏览或接受/拒绝修订时,需要频繁进行数据比对和刷新,极易耗尽资源并导致崩溃。定期定稿、接受所有修订并删除批注是控制体积的必要步骤。 十一、 自动保存与后台进程的资源争夺 Word默认启用的“自动保存”功能是一把双刃剑。它定期在后台将文档的当前状态写入临时文件。对于超大型文档,这个后台保存操作本身就需要占用大量的输入输出和处理器资源。如果恰好在自动保存的瞬间,用户又在进行其他高负载操作(如插入新图片、重新分页),前台与后台进程对资源的激烈争夺可能直接导致程序锁死或崩溃。适当延长自动保存的时间间隔对大文档处理有益。 十二、 软件自身的设计限制与错误 最后,不得不提软件自身的局限。任何程序在设计时都会有理论上的处理上限,例如对文件大小、页码数量、样式数量的限制。虽然微软官方并未明确给出一个绝对的崩溃临界值,但实践中,当文档体积超过一定范围(例如数百兆字节),它就可能触碰到Word内部某个未经验证的代码路径,引发内存访问违规等底层错误,从而导致不可恢复的应用程序故障。此外,软件本身存在的未修复的程序错误(Bug),也可能在特定的大文档操作场景下被触发。 十三、 链接到外部文件的稳定性风险 如果文档中并非嵌入对象,而是使用了大量链接到外部文件(如图片链接、图表数据链接),那么文档的稳定性就与外链文件的路径稳定性紧密绑定。当打开文档时,Word会尝试去读取这些链接。如果外链文件被移动、重命名或删除,或者网络驱动器连接不稳定,Word的尝试读取操作可能陷入长时间的等待或报错。在大文档中,多个失效链接同时尝试解析,会严重阻塞打开流程,甚至导致崩溃。 十四、 长表格与嵌套表格的计算复杂性 文档中包含横跨多页的长表格,或者在单元格内再次嵌套表格,会极大地增加排版引擎的计算负担。Word需要精确计算每一个单元格的尺寸、文本流和分页位置。当表格非常庞大且结构复杂时,任何细微的修改(如调整某一列宽)都可能引发整个表格的连锁重算。这种计算密集型操作会短时间内占用大量处理器资源,如果计算过程出现逻辑矛盾或超时,就可能直接引起程序无响应。 十五、 文档保护与加密的开销 对文档施加密码保护或限制编辑权限,意味着Word在每次打开、保存甚至滚动时,都需要进行额外的加密解密运算或权限校验。对于小文档,这种开销微不足道。但对于一个体积庞大的文档,持续的加解密操作会成为显著的性能拖累,尤其是在配置较低的计算机上。这种额外的处理负担叠加在其他因素之上,进一步提高了系统过载和崩溃的概率。 十六、 系统环境与冲突软件的影响 Word并非在真空中运行。操作系统本身的稳定性、已安装的更新补丁、驱动程序(特别是显卡驱动)的版本,以及其他后台运行的软件(如杀毒防护软件、云盘同步客户端)都可能产生影响。某些安全软件会对Word的文档读写操作进行实时扫描,对于大文件的频繁扫描会严重拖慢速度。同时,有缺陷的打印机驱动程序在执行打印预览或打印大文档时,也常常是引发Word崩溃的元凶之一。 综上所述,Word文档过大导致的崩溃是一个多因素交织的系统性问题,从硬件资源、文档内部结构到软件环境和操作习惯,每一个环节都可能成为压垮骆驼的最后一根稻草。理解这些原因,有助于我们采取针对性的预防措施,例如优化图片、清理格式、管理修订历史、定期维护文档结构,从而确保大型文档的稳定与高效处理,让我们的工作不再因意外的崩溃而中断。
相关文章
在数字设备的核心深处,ROM(只读存储器)扮演着基础且关键的角色。它并非简单的存储单元,而是一种固化指令与数据的非易失性存储器。从启动计算机的基本输入输出系统,到各类嵌入式设备与游戏卡带中的固定程序,ROM确保了设备能够可靠地初始化并执行其核心功能。本文将深入解析ROM的定义、工作原理、主要类型、技术演进及其在当代与未来科技中的广泛应用,为您揭开这项基础技术的神秘面纱。
2026-05-02 15:42:11
274人看过
txt文档与word文档是日常办公中最为常见的两种文档格式,但它们的核心差异远不止于文件后缀。txt是一种仅包含纯文本的极简格式,其本质是字符编码的序列,不具备任何格式设置功能。而word文档则是一个功能丰富的复合文档,集文本、样式、图像、表格等多种元素于一体,支持复杂的排版与编辑。本文将从文件本质、功能特性、应用场景、兼容性、安全性等十二个维度进行深入剖析,帮助读者全面理解两者的根本区别与适用选择。
2026-05-02 15:41:39
330人看过
苹果6外屏维修费用并非固定不变,其价格受到维修渠道、屏幕品质、维修方式以及地域因素的综合影响。本文将为您深入剖析官方与非官方维修的成本差异,详解原装、原厂品质与普通外屏的区别,并提供如何根据自身需求选择最合适维修方案的实用建议。通过了解维修背后的技术细节与市场行情,您将能够做出明智的决策,避免不必要的花费。
2026-05-02 15:40:41
149人看过
甲类功放以其极低的失真和温暖音色,成为众多音响发烧友的终极追求。本文将为您深入解析甲类功放的独特魅力,从核心工作原理到其与乙类、甲乙类的本质区别,再到如何根据预算与听音偏好,在经典品牌与现代创新之间做出明智选择,助您找到那台能真正触动心弦的音响灵魂。
2026-05-02 15:40:34
378人看过
在多元化的数字时代,我们时常会遇到像“mico”这样的名称。它究竟是社交平台、品牌标识,还是技术术语?其正确的发音方式不仅关乎日常交流的准确性,更涉及对其背后文化与功能的深入理解。本文将为您系统解析“mico”的多种读音可能、来源背景以及在不同语境下的应用,助您清晰、自信地掌握这个词汇。
2026-05-02 15:40:17
165人看过
在数据处理与呈现的日常工作中,表格单元格内文本的排列方式直接影响着文档的美观度与可读性。许多用户,无论是初学者还是有一定经验的操作者,常常会对一个基础但关键的设置产生疑问:表格软件中默认的垂直对齐方式究竟是什么?本文将深入探讨这一默认设置的具体内容、其设计背后的逻辑、在不同情境下的实际表现,以及如何根据需求进行高效调整,旨在为用户提供一份全面而实用的操作指南。
2026-05-02 15:40:14
94人看过
热门推荐
资讯中心:
.webp)

.webp)


